Charged Vector Particles Tunneling From A Pair of Accelerating and Rotating and 5D Gauged Super-Gravity Black Holes

Abstract

The aim of this paper is to study the quantum tunneling process for charged vector particles through the horizons of black holes by using Proca equation. For this purpose, we have consider a pair of charged accelerating and rotating black holes with NUT parameter and a black hole in 5D gauged supergravity, respectively. Further, we have studied the tunneling probability and corresponding Hawking temperature for both black holes by using WKB approximation.
